When I made my first chassis, in 1976, and approached a tube supply company called Hub & Gillespie in north London, on explaining what I needed it for they immediateley said that they were the company that supplied Zip Karts with tube, and that it was an ordinary spec of CDS tube. They still trade as Hub le Bas, and I still use CFS3 from them when making chassis, although I have plans to make one from T45 when I can get the money together (its very expensive), just to see what difference it makes. Chassis these days just dont seem to be as durable as they were in the old days, and I attribute this to the use of mig welding which produces a stress raising small fillet profile and embrittlement of the tubing due to the high temperature, so I still bronze weld mine.
